Hard to cancel... use at own risk
Used it for 10 minutes cos of the advertising, but it didnt quite produce what i wanted. Went to cancel, and like many, I can confirm 100% that the "help" page they provide to cancel is a lie... the page has a video showing a manage button, however, this button doesn't seem to exist in real life (i have screenshots etc).
their chat bot was pretty useless, as it said the same thing, but then said something similar to "email them directly". Googling the cancelation process, it appears many have struggled to cancel A FREE TRIAL, and still get charged later for their "trial".
while its nice to have the "owner" reply to some of these saying...
1:"there is a button to cancel."... if its there, at best its well hidden and not in line with the documentation on their site and at worst, its just not there (aligned to the many comments already stated, including my experience)
2: "you are charged cos you used over the allowed ai credits" (which seems to be other feedback), then maybe block user and say "you are out of credit, would you want to buy some credits?" rather then just chew and bill... they say in their terms of services "We are responsible for communicating those fees to you clearly and accurately, and letting you know well in advance if those prices change", but clearly they havent done well on this front....
3: TOS - "We will immediately bill you when you upgrade from the free plan to any paying plan." - i havent tried this but im assuming if you switch the plan even though you are 14 days free trial, you start paying straight away... if so, choose your trial plan carefully
The whole thing just seems to be a bit misleading, it wasnt a good experiene, i didnt get what i wanted as a design out of it (the output was really rough, bad routing etc, the schematic were not clear etc felt like a 10 year old kid scribbled to make it)
ive had to resort to cancelling credit card so i can feel confident i wont have other issues / charges later for my trial.
Sign up at own risk, be prepared to change credit cards (or use a disposable one)

Title: AI Copilot cannot actually place components — only generates text instructions
Review:
I tested Flux.ai with a real industrial PCB project (LLC V3 — 180 components, 18 ICs, isolated power supply, CAN/RS485 communication, impedance measurement). Here is my honest experience:
What worked:
- Knowledge Base: Successfully stored design rules, pin maps, and component specs
- Copilot understands complex designs and generates well-structured analysis tables
What completely failed:
- Copilot CANNOT place components on the schematic. After 45 minutes and ~7 ACUs spent, zero components were placed on the canvas.
- When asked to "build the power supply section," Copilot replied: "I can't execute that whole section in one shot" and demanded atomic steps.
- When given atomic steps ("Add a 2-pin terminal block for J1"), Copilot replied: "I can't directly place J1 from this chat runtime."
- Even Copilot's own "Generate implementation prompt" feature produced a prompt that Copilot itself couldn't execute.
- The Schematic editor's Chat has the same limitation — "execution tools not available in this runtime."
The marketing says "Design PCBs with AI" and "From idea to schematic." In reality, the AI is a text advisor that tells you what to do but cannot do it. It's like hiring an architect who describes walls and doors but refuses to pick up a pencil.
For the same project, KiCad (free) or EasyEDA Pro (free) would have been far more productive. I cannot recommend Flux.ai for any project beyond the simplest LED-blink boards.
Plan: Starter (Pro Free Trial)
Project: Industrial liquid level controller, 10 schematic sheets
Test date: March 2026

Delivered a Working PCB and Unblocked Project Delivery — Great Community Support
The Flux team have clearly worked hard to deliver not only a great browser based PCB design tool that cuts through the noise, but a great community for genius level hardware designers and newbies alike.
Their focus on community has definitively paid off, as plenty of great folk are willing to help you along the way. If you need something - just ask.
The AI Tooling is immature as it stands, but it's worth considering that there are few tools attempting this and having a realistic expectation is important. I've had mixed results however I think with time it will become a useful addition.
Flux has managed to help me deliver a PCB project from inception to delivery. I am not a hardware engineer. It makes me _feel_ like one.
